What is a TTRPG?
A tabletop role-playing game (TTRPG) is a collaborative storytelling experience. One person — the Game Master or Dungeon Master — narrates the world. Everyone else plays a character living inside it. You make choices, roll dice, and see what happens.
That's it. There's no screen, no graphics card required, no loading times. Just imagination, some friends, and a set of funny-shaped dice.
Where to start
In a perfect world, the easiest entry point at the time of writing in 2026 is Dungeons & Dragons 5th Edition. It has the largest community, the most beginner resources, and a free rules document so you can try before you buy.
